Answer:

a.–12 – 18

Step-by-step explanation:

We have to compute the difference (the subtraction) between the new, colder temperature, which is equal to -12 °C, and the original temperature, which is equal to 18 °C, that is:

colder temperature - original temperature

Replacing with data:

-12 °C - 18 °C = -30 °C
